How to maintain a common mode choke?
Common Mode Chokes are essential components in many electronic devices and equipment that help reduce electromagnetic interference (EMI) and ensure the smooth operation of circuits. To maintain the efficiency and longevity of common mode chokes, regular maintenance and care are necessary. Here are some tips for maintaining a common mode choke:
1. Inspect for Physical Damage: Regularly inspect the common mode choke for any physical damage such as cracks, dents, or corrosion. Physical damage can affect the performance of the choke and lead to increased EMI. If any damage is found, replace the choke immediately.
2. Clean the Choke: Dust, dirt, and debris can accumulate on the surface of the choke, affecting its performance. Use a soft brush or compressed air to gently clean the choke and remove any buildup. Avoid using harsh chemicals or cleaning agents that may damage the choke.
3. Check for Loose Connections: Ensure that the connections to the common mode choke are secure and tight. Loose connections can lead to poor contact and increased EMI. Inspect the solder joints and terminals for any signs of corrosion or damage.
4. Monitor Temperature: Common mode chokes can generate heat during operation, especially when handling high currents. Ensure that the choke is not overheating, as excessive heat can lead to degradation of the insulation material and reduce the choke’s effectiveness. Use thermal imaging or temperature sensors to monitor the temperature of the choke.
5. Test for Functionality: Periodically test the common mode choke for functionality to ensure that it is effectively reducing EMI. Use a spectrum analyzer or oscilloscope to measure the noise levels before and after the choke to verify its performance. Replace the choke if it is not providing sufficient noise suppression.
6. Follow Manufacturer’s Recommendations: Follow the manufacturer’s guidelines and recommendations for maintaining the common mode choke. Some chokes may require specific cleaning methods or periodic inspections to ensure optimal performance. Refer to the manufacturer’s documentation for detailed maintenance instructions.
7. Protect from Environmental Factors: Protect the common mode choke from environmental factors such as moisture, humidity, and extreme temperatures. Ensure that the choke is installed in a clean and dry environment away from sources of heat or moisture. Use protective enclosures or covers to shield the choke from external elements.
8. Replace when Necessary: Common mode chokes have a limited lifespan and may degrade over time due to factors such as temperature, current, and voltage stress. Monitor the performance of the choke and replace it when it shows signs of deterioration or if it fails to meet the required noise suppression levels.
